**Checklist item 7 — Fan-out backpressure verification (Pellorin Notify).** Before approving the release, confirm the notification fan-out respects backpressure: load the staging broker to 80% of rated throughput and watch the dispatcher. It should shed to the deferred queue rather than retrying hot — if you see retry storms in the dispatcher logs, stop and flag it; do not proceed. This catches the regression we shipped last quarter. Record your result in the sign-off sheet alongside the build token shown below.

session token of yajof-bagef = htk4_937d

Release step 9 — ReminderSync job, Westhollow Clinic platform. Confirm the artifact checksum matches the build manifest before promotion, and verify that patient-facing message templates were reviewed under change ticket procedure. The job must run under the restricted service account only; any broader scope is a release blocker. Audit logging for outbound reminders must be enabled and verified in the staging capture. After all checks above are recorded in the release log, install the deploy signing key provided immediately below.

rollout seal: bky4_x7Gc

Q: The Velvetstage seat-map renderer is showing phantom "held" seats — what gives? A: Usually the hold-cache for the Marquee venue tier didn't flush after a show closed. Kick the cache job and re-render; takes about a minute. If seats stay stuck, escalate. Full troubleshooting steps are on the internal page here:

wiki page, tahaf-tajog: https://jira.ordindyn.corp/pipeline

Alert: ChatterBeacon log volume breach. Hey — this fires when the Murmurd service pushes more than 2M log lines per hour, which usually means sampling got disabled somewhere. Murmurd is famously chatty, so we sample its debug logs at 1% in every environment. If this alert is firing, someone probably shipped a config with sampling off, or a crash loop is spamming errors. Don't just silence it — unsampled Murmurd can fill the log cluster in a day. Steps to re-enable sampling are on the page below.

operations page: https://jenkins.zemvarcloud.local/job/merge_requests/repo/build/73930b4b30f0a8ed